Hey Fellas , so I’m getting close to starting my 2.4L. I’ve read that the original 6 takes 9 quarts. Mine is slightly larger as stated. I want to start adding oil to the system. Not only to look for leaks but want to get some in the block so I can rotate her without fear of
scuffing up metal that shouldn’t. I know your supposed to check when hot and running. How much would you add at first. Any starting procedure tips. It is carbed and does NOT have a front cooler.
